Introduction
In the present competitive business environment, the hospitality industry demands efficient
management who have the capability to carry out the tasks and responsibilities in an efficient
manner (Moss, 2018). Employability skills are the competencies that are required by the business
firms for any job role. Thus, it is important for an individual to possess various skill set and
competencies to fulfil the responsibilities of the job role.
The present writing is based on identifying the skills and abilities that are needed for the manager
of a hotel, Travelodge. Further, it also outlines various motivational techniques that influence the
employees of the organization to work better. Also, the report is concerned about various work-
based problems that interrupt the performance and quality of work within the organization.

Task 1
Introduction
This task is carried out in order to develop a set of responsibilities while working as a manager of
Travelodge. The major role of a manager of Travelodge is to identify and satisfy the needs of
customers, taking feedback and meeting the standards of the hotel.
1.1 Develop a set of own responsibilities and performance objectives
In order to meet the standards of the company in this competitive business environment, it is a
very challenging task for the manager of the company. Being a manager of such a renowned
organization, Travelodge it is essential to have some set of own skills and responsibilities to meet
the specific criteria. Some of the specific skills which I am required to develop in order to work
as a manager in the cited organization are:
Problem solving
Effective communication
Team work
Creativity
Leadership
Commercial awareness
The first and foremost competency or responsibility of a manager is to know how to handle a
particular situation and problem (Collet, et. al., 2015). Hospitality industry emphasizes on
satisfying the needs and demands of the customers. Thus, the manager must have such skills to
resolve the issues and problems of the customers as well as subordinates in a creative and
effective manner. To deal with such kind of situations within organization, the manager is
required to possess good communication skill. Along with to guide and inspire the employees of
Travelodge in attaining the predetermined goals, leadership skills play a vital role. Performance
objectives can be set by using the SMART model. It refers to specific, measurable, achievable,
and realistic and timeliness. The performance objectives as a manager of the Travelodge are time
management skills, improved feedback of customers, enhance communication, increasing
productivity and supporting and managing change and improving retention rates.

1.4 Review how motivational techniques can be used to improve quality of performance
Motivational techniques are very helpful in achieving the objective of the company (Messum, et.
al., 2016). These are the tools and methods that encourage and inspire the employees in the
organization to perform better and attaining the objectives. There are several methods and
models that can be adopted by the cited organization. These motivational theories include
Maslow’s need hierarchy theory, Herzberg’s two-factor theories, McGregor’s X and Y theory
etc.
Concerning the cited organization, Maslow’s need hierarchy theory is effective in accomplishing
the goals and objectives of the hotel. The theory states that human needs are categorized at
different levels such as (Guilbert, et. al., 2016)
Figure 1: Maslow's need hierarchy
Some other techniques to improve work quality and morale of the employees to enhance
productivity are creating a positive work environment, financial rewards, recognizing
achievements, appreciating efforts, facilitating open communication etc. (Jackson and Oliver,
2018).
Establishing a positive work environment and work culture creates a healthy employment
relationship that positively impacts on the work performance of employees (Valero, et al. 2018).
Apart from this, providing incentives and monetary rewards also encourages the enthusiasm
level of employees to perform tasks in a better way.
